Как успешно синхронизировать ОБД — эффективные методы и полезные советы

Синхронизация баз данных (ОБД) является одной из важнейших задач в области информационных технологий. Независимо от типа ОБД, использование правильных методов синхронизации является необходимостью для обеспечения целостности данных и эффективного функционирования приложений.

Одним из наиболее распространенных методов синхронизации ОБД является репликация данных. При репликации данные из исходной базы данных копируются в одну или несколько целевых баз данных. Это позволяет распределить нагрузку на несколько серверов, обеспечить отказоустойчивость системы и повысить производительность.

Вторым методом синхронизации ОБД является использование транзакций. Транзакция представляет собой логическую единицу работы с базой данных, которая состоит из одного или нескольких запросов. При использовании транзакций изменения в базе данных синхронизируются и либо все выполняются успешно, либо откатываются к исходному состоянию.

Однако, помимо выбора метода синхронизации, существует несколько советов, которые помогут избежать проблем и сделать синхронизацию ОБД более эффективной. Во-первых, необходимо регулярно резервировать данные и лог файлы, чтобы иметь возможность восстановить базу данных в случае сбоя или ошибки.

Во-вторых, следует тщательно планировать процесс обновления базы данных. Необходимо учитывать зависимости между таблицами и проводить обновления в правильном порядке, чтобы избежать возникновения конфликтов и ошибок. Кроме того, стоит проводить синхронизацию в период минимальной активности системы, чтобы избежать негативного влияния на производительность.

Синхронизация ОБД: важные аспекты

Вот несколько важных аспектов, которые следует учесть при синхронизации ОБД:

  1. Выбор правильного метода синхронизации: Существует несколько методов синхронизации ОБД, таких как репликация и мастер-слейв архитектура. Необходимо выбрать метод, который наилучшим образом соответствует особенностям вашего проекта.
  2. Установка регулярного расписания синхронизации: Чтобы избежать потери данных и несоответствия информации, рекомендуется установить регулярное расписание синхронизации. Таким образом, данные будут обновляться автоматически в заданное время.
  3. Проверка целостности данных: Перед синхронизацией необходимо проверить целостность данных в ОБД. Это можно сделать с помощью различных инструментов и методов проверки, таких как проверка уникальности значений и связей между таблицами.
  4. Обработка конфликтов: В случае возникновения конфликтов при синхронизации, необходимо предусмотреть механизм их обработки. Это может включать в себя определение приоритета данных, разрешение конфликтов вручную или автоматическое решение с помощью правил.
  5. Резервное копирование данных: Важно регулярно делать резервные копии ОБД перед синхронизацией. Это позволит восстановить данные в случае сбоев или ошибок в процессе синхронизации.

Учитывая все эти важные аспекты, вы сможете эффективно синхронизировать ОБД и быть увереными в ее надежности и актуальности.

Почему синхронизация ОБД важна?

Синхронизация ОБД позволяет поддерживать актуальность данных и предотвращать их потерю. Если база данных не синхронизирована, возникают проблемы с целостностью данных, дублированием информации и проблемы доступа к неправильным данным. Это может привести к неправильным решениям, ошибкам в работе и возможным финансовым потерям для организации.

Синхронизация ОБД позволяет сохранять данные в актуальном и надежном состоянии. Это особенно важно в условиях, когда используется несколько копий базы данных на разных серверах или устанавливаются автономные копии базы данных на региональных серверах. Благодаря этой синхронизации все данные регулярно обновляются и становятся доступными для всех сотрудников.

Другой важный аспект синхронизации ОБД — это сохранение работы данных при возникновении проблем или смещении времени. Если ОБД не синхронизирована, возникает риск потерять данные, которые были внесены после последней синхронизации. Все эти риски отсутствуют при правильной синхронизации базы данных.

Таким образом, синхронизация ОБД играет ключевую роль в поддержании надежности, актуальности и целостности данных. Она предотвращает возможные ошибки, снижает риск потери данных и позволяет эффективно использовать информацию для принятия важных решений в бизнесе.

Методы синхронизации ОБД

1. Репликация: репликация является одним из наиболее распространенных и действенных методов синхронизации ОБД. Она включает создание и поддержание копий основной базы данных на других серверах. Репликация позволяет распределить нагрузку и улучшить производительность системы, а также обеспечить отказоустойчивость данных.

2. Управление транзакциями: управление транзакциями — это метод синхронизации, который позволяет обеспечить целостность данных путем гарантирования, что все изменения базы данных будут либо полностью выполнены, либо отменены. Это достигается путем использования транзакций, которые обеспечивают атомарность, согласованность, изолированность и прочность данных.

3. Событийное управление: событийное управление — это метод синхронизации ОБД, который использует механизм событий для оповещения о внесении изменений в базу данных. При возникновении события, связанного с изменением данных, уведомление отправляется другим компонентам системы, что позволяет им обновить свои данные и оставаться синхронизированными.

4. Реактивные системы: реактивные системы — это метод синхронизации, который основан на использовании стримов данных. В реактивных системах данные передаются в виде потоков событий, и изменения автоматически распространяются на все подписанные компоненты системы. Это позволяет достигнуть высокой скорости обработки данных и обеспечить мгновенную синхронизацию.

Выбор метода синхронизации ОБД зависит от конкретных требований и особенностей системы. Что бы вы ни выбрали, важно учесть все возможные риски и преимущества каждого метода, чтобы обеспечить эффективную и надежную синхронизацию данных в вашей системе.

Шаги для успешной синхронизации

  1. Подготовка данных: перед синхронизацией необходимо убедиться, что ваши данные готовы к обновлению. Проверьте, что все необходимые записи находятся в базе данных и что они актуальны.
  2. Выбор метода синхронизации: определите, какой метод синхронизации наиболее подходит для вашей базы данных. Возможны различные подходы, такие как репликация, слияние или обновление данных.
  3. Резервное копирование: перед выполнением синхронизации рекомендуется создать резервную копию базы данных. Это позволит вам вернуться к предыдущей версии данных в случае возникновения проблем.
  4. Установка параметров синхронизации: настройте параметры синхронизации в соответствии с вашими потребностями. Это может включать указание интервала синхронизации, выбор полей для обновления и другие параметры.
  5. Тестирование и проверка: перед полноценной синхронизацией рекомендуется протестировать процесс на небольших объемах данных. Убедитесь, что все работает корректно и что данные синхронизируются без ошибок.
  6. Запуск синхронизации: когда все готово, можно запустить процесс синхронизации. Отслеживайте прогресс и убедитесь, что нет ошибок или проблем.
  7. Мониторинг и обслуживание: после завершения синхронизации важно регулярно мониторить базу данных и следить за ее состоянием. При необходимости проводите дополнительные синхронизации или исправления.

Следуя этим шагам, вы сможете успешно синхронизировать базу данных без проблем и обеспечить актуальность и надежность ваших данных.

Полезные советы по синхронизации ОБД

1. Создайте резервную копию данных: Перед выполнением синхронизации ОБД рекомендуется создать резервную копию данных. Это позволит вам вернуться к предыдущему состоянию базы данных в случае неудачного синхронизации.

2. Используйте транзакции: Транзакции позволяют выполнить группу операций как единое целое. Это гарантирует согласованность данных в случае возникновения сбоев или ошибок.

3. Установите режим автоматической синхронизации: Большинство современных ОБД поддерживают автоматическую синхронизацию данных. Убедитесь, что данная функция включена, чтобы минимизировать риски возникновения проблем с целостностью данных.

4. Проверяйте индексы: Индексы помогают ускорить выполнение запросов к базе данных. Периодически проверяйте состояние индексов и обновляйте или перестраивайте их при необходимости.

5. Используйте уникальные идентификаторы: При работе с распределенными ОБД важно использовать уникальные идентификаторы для предотвращения дублирования данных и конфликтов.

6. Ограничивайте доступ к данным: Предоставляйте доступ к данным только тем пользователям, которым это необходимо. Ограничение доступа поможет предотвратить случайное или нежелательное изменение данных.

Следуя этим советам, вы сможете синхронизировать ОБД без проблем и обеспечить надежность и актуальность ваших данных.

Автоматизация синхронизации ОБД

Автоматизация процесса синхронизации становится все более важной, поскольку он способствует более эффективной работе с базами данных. При использовании подходящих средств автоматизации вы сможете значительно сэкономить время и ресурсы. В этом разделе мы рассмотрим некоторые методы и советы по автоматизации синхронизации ОБД.

  • Используйте инструменты для автоматической синхронизации: Существует множество инструментов, которые позволяют автоматизировать процесс синхронизации ОБД. Некоторые из них предоставляют функции синхронизации в реальном времени, что позволяет обнаруживать и решать проблемы моментально.
  • Настройте расписания автоматической синхронизации: Определите оптимальные временные интервалы для автоматической синхронизации. Это позволит избежать вмешательства в работу пользователя и снизить нагрузку на систему во время процесса синхронизации.
  • Используйте многопоточность: Если у вас большое количество ОБД, можно использовать многопоточность для параллельной синхронизации нескольких баз данных одновременно. Это значительно увеличит эффективность и скорость синхронизации.
  • Мониторинг и журналирование: Важно иметь возможность отслеживать процесс синхронизации и регистрировать все изменения в базе данных. Это поможет быстро обнаружить и исправить любые проблемы, а также восстановить базу данных в случае сбоя.

Автоматизация синхронизации ОБД — это важная задача, которая помогает обеспечить стабильность и надежность работы с базами данных. С использованием подходящих инструментов и методов, вы сможете синхронизировать ОБД без проблем и сэкономить время и ресурсы вашей организации.

Оцените статью

Как успешно синхронизировать ОБД — эффективные методы и полезные советы

Синхронизация баз данных (ОБД) является одной из важнейших задач в области информационных технологий. Независимо от типа ОБД, использование правильных методов синхронизации является необходимостью для обеспечения целостности данных и эффективного функционирования приложений.

Одним из наиболее распространенных методов синхронизации ОБД является репликация данных. При репликации данные из исходной базы данных копируются в одну или несколько целевых баз данных. Это позволяет распределить нагрузку на несколько серверов, обеспечить отказоустойчивость системы и повысить производительность.

Вторым методом синхронизации ОБД является использование транзакций. Транзакция представляет собой логическую единицу работы с базой данных, которая состоит из одного или нескольких запросов. При использовании транзакций изменения в базе данных синхронизируются и либо все выполняются успешно, либо откатываются к исходному состоянию.

Однако, помимо выбора метода синхронизации, существует несколько советов, которые помогут избежать проблем и сделать синхронизацию ОБД более эффективной. Во-первых, необходимо регулярно резервировать данные и лог файлы, чтобы иметь возможность восстановить базу данных в случае сбоя или ошибки.

Во-вторых, следует тщательно планировать процесс обновления базы данных. Необходимо учитывать зависимости между таблицами и проводить обновления в правильном порядке, чтобы избежать возникновения конфликтов и ошибок. Кроме того, стоит проводить синхронизацию в период минимальной активности системы, чтобы избежать негативного влияния на производительность.

Синхронизация ОБД: важные аспекты

Вот несколько важных аспектов, которые следует учесть при синхронизации ОБД:

  1. Выбор правильного метода синхронизации: Существует несколько методов синхронизации ОБД, таких как репликация и мастер-слейв архитектура. Необходимо выбрать метод, который наилучшим образом соответствует особенностям вашего проекта.
  2. Установка регулярного расписания синхронизации: Чтобы избежать потери данных и несоответствия информации, рекомендуется установить регулярное расписание синхронизации. Таким образом, данные будут обновляться автоматически в заданное время.
  3. Проверка целостности данных: Перед синхронизацией необходимо проверить целостность данных в ОБД. Это можно сделать с помощью различных инструментов и методов проверки, таких как проверка уникальности значений и связей между таблицами.
  4. Обработка конфликтов: В случае возникновения конфликтов при синхронизации, необходимо предусмотреть механизм их обработки. Это может включать в себя определение приоритета данных, разрешение конфликтов вручную или автоматическое решение с помощью правил.
  5. Резервное копирование данных: Важно регулярно делать резервные копии ОБД перед синхронизацией. Это позволит восстановить данные в случае сбоев или ошибок в процессе синхронизации.

Учитывая все эти важные аспекты, вы сможете эффективно синхронизировать ОБД и быть увереными в ее надежности и актуальности.

Почему синхронизация ОБД важна?

Синхронизация ОБД позволяет поддерживать актуальность данных и предотвращать их потерю. Если база данных не синхронизирована, возникают проблемы с целостностью данных, дублированием информации и проблемы доступа к неправильным данным. Это может привести к неправильным решениям, ошибкам в работе и возможным финансовым потерям для организации.

Синхронизация ОБД позволяет сохранять данные в актуальном и надежном состоянии. Это особенно важно в условиях, когда используется несколько копий базы данных на разных серверах или устанавливаются автономные копии базы данных на региональных серверах. Благодаря этой синхронизации все данные регулярно обновляются и становятся доступными для всех сотрудников.

Другой важный аспект синхронизации ОБД — это сохранение работы данных при возникновении проблем или смещении времени. Если ОБД не синхронизирована, возникает риск потерять данные, которые были внесены после последней синхронизации. Все эти риски отсутствуют при правильной синхронизации базы данных.

Таким образом, синхронизация ОБД играет ключевую роль в поддержании надежности, актуальности и целостности данных. Она предотвращает возможные ошибки, снижает риск потери данных и позволяет эффективно использовать информацию для принятия важных решений в бизнесе.

Методы синхронизации ОБД

1. Репликация: репликация является одним из наиболее распространенных и действенных методов синхронизации ОБД. Она включает создание и поддержание копий основной базы данных на других серверах. Репликация позволяет распределить нагрузку и улучшить производительность системы, а также обеспечить отказоустойчивость данных.

2. Управление транзакциями: управление транзакциями — это метод синхронизации, который позволяет обеспечить целостность данных путем гарантирования, что все изменения базы данных будут либо полностью выполнены, либо отменены. Это достигается путем использования транзакций, которые обеспечивают атомарность, согласованность, изолированность и прочность данных.

3. Событийное управление: событийное управление — это метод синхронизации ОБД, который использует механизм событий для оповещения о внесении изменений в базу данных. При возникновении события, связанного с изменением данных, уведомление отправляется другим компонентам системы, что позволяет им обновить свои данные и оставаться синхронизированными.

4. Реактивные системы: реактивные системы — это метод синхронизации, который основан на использовании стримов данных. В реактивных системах данные передаются в виде потоков событий, и изменения автоматически распространяются на все подписанные компоненты системы. Это позволяет достигнуть высокой скорости обработки данных и обеспечить мгновенную синхронизацию.

Выбор метода синхронизации ОБД зависит от конкретных требований и особенностей системы. Что бы вы ни выбрали, важно учесть все возможные риски и преимущества каждого метода, чтобы обеспечить эффективную и надежную синхронизацию данных в вашей системе.

Шаги для успешной синхронизации

  1. Подготовка данных: перед синхронизацией необходимо убедиться, что ваши данные готовы к обновлению. Проверьте, что все необходимые записи находятся в базе данных и что они актуальны.
  2. Выбор метода синхронизации: определите, какой метод синхронизации наиболее подходит для вашей базы данных. Возможны различные подходы, такие как репликация, слияние или обновление данных.
  3. Резервное копирование: перед выполнением синхронизации рекомендуется создать резервную копию базы данных. Это позволит вам вернуться к предыдущей версии данных в случае возникновения проблем.
  4. Установка параметров синхронизации: настройте параметры синхронизации в соответствии с вашими потребностями. Это может включать указание интервала синхронизации, выбор полей для обновления и другие параметры.
  5. Тестирование и проверка: перед полноценной синхронизацией рекомендуется протестировать процесс на небольших объемах данных. Убедитесь, что все работает корректно и что данные синхронизируются без ошибок.
  6. Запуск синхронизации: когда все готово, можно запустить процесс синхронизации. Отслеживайте прогресс и убедитесь, что нет ошибок или проблем.
  7. Мониторинг и обслуживание: после завершения синхронизации важно регулярно мониторить базу данных и следить за ее состоянием. При необходимости проводите дополнительные синхронизации или исправления.

Следуя этим шагам, вы сможете успешно синхронизировать базу данных без проблем и обеспечить актуальность и надежность ваших данных.

Полезные советы по синхронизации ОБД

1. Создайте резервную копию данных: Перед выполнением синхронизации ОБД рекомендуется создать резервную копию данных. Это позволит вам вернуться к предыдущему состоянию базы данных в случае неудачного синхронизации.

2. Используйте транзакции: Транзакции позволяют выполнить группу операций как единое целое. Это гарантирует согласованность данных в случае возникновения сбоев или ошибок.

3. Установите режим автоматической синхронизации: Большинство современных ОБД поддерживают автоматическую синхронизацию данных. Убедитесь, что данная функция включена, чтобы минимизировать риски возникновения проблем с целостностью данных.

4. Проверяйте индексы: Индексы помогают ускорить выполнение запросов к базе данных. Периодически проверяйте состояние индексов и обновляйте или перестраивайте их при необходимости.

5. Используйте уникальные идентификаторы: При работе с распределенными ОБД важно использовать уникальные идентификаторы для предотвращения дублирования данных и конфликтов.

6. Ограничивайте доступ к данным: Предоставляйте доступ к данным только тем пользователям, которым это необходимо. Ограничение доступа поможет предотвратить случайное или нежелательное изменение данных.

Следуя этим советам, вы сможете синхронизировать ОБД без проблем и обеспечить надежность и актуальность ваших данных.

Автоматизация синхронизации ОБД

Автоматизация процесса синхронизации становится все более важной, поскольку он способствует более эффективной работе с базами данных. При использовании подходящих средств автоматизации вы сможете значительно сэкономить время и ресурсы. В этом разделе мы рассмотрим некоторые методы и советы по автоматизации синхронизации ОБД.

  • Используйте инструменты для автоматической синхронизации: Существует множество инструментов, которые позволяют автоматизировать процесс синхронизации ОБД. Некоторые из них предоставляют функции синхронизации в реальном времени, что позволяет обнаруживать и решать проблемы моментально.
  • Настройте расписания автоматической синхронизации: Определите оптимальные временные интервалы для автоматической синхронизации. Это позволит избежать вмешательства в работу пользователя и снизить нагрузку на систему во время процесса синхронизации.
  • Используйте многопоточность: Если у вас большое количество ОБД, можно использовать многопоточность для параллельной синхронизации нескольких баз данных одновременно. Это значительно увеличит эффективность и скорость синхронизации.
  • Мониторинг и журналирование: Важно иметь возможность отслеживать процесс синхронизации и регистрировать все изменения в базе данных. Это поможет быстро обнаружить и исправить любые проблемы, а также восстановить базу данных в случае сбоя.

Автоматизация синхронизации ОБД — это важная задача, которая помогает обеспечить стабильность и надежность работы с базами данных. С использованием подходящих инструментов и методов, вы сможете синхронизировать ОБД без проблем и сэкономить время и ресурсы вашей организации.

Оцените статью